The Old Peat Cottage in Beanthwaite, Cumbria sleeps two in one bedroom.
The living areas in the property consist of an open-plan living area with a kitchen with an electric oven, ceramic h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, washer/dryer, dining seating for two people, and a sitting room with Smart TV and electric fire. There is a king-size, along with a ground-floor shower room and a first-floor cloakroom. Outside there is an enclosed front garden with patio and furniture, and roadside parking is available. Within 0.7 miles you will find a shop and a pub, and please note that two well-behaved, small-sized dogs are allowed but sorry, no smoking. WiFi, fuel, power, bed linen and towels are all included in the price. The Old Peat Cottage is a wonderful dwelling for exploring the Lake District with loved ones. Note: The stairs to the first-floor are space saving and half open-tread, not suitable for those with lower mobility

Town: Grizebeck is located on the edge of the Lake District National Park and offers breath-taking panoramic views of the Furness Fells, the Coniston Mountains, and the Duddon Estuary. Grizebeck, which is located in a lovely rural area, is ideal for anyone who wish to get away from it all for a while. The local garage has a little store that is perfect for essentials, and there is a tavern in the village that serves evening meals and local beers. You can reach Kirkby-in-Furness, a community with a general shop, two pubs, and a train station, in a short amount of time by car. The market town of Ulverston, which is located east of Kirkby-in-Furness, is widely known for its seasonal street markets and festivals. The town of Broughton-in-Furness, which contains three pubs, Beswicks Restaurant, a bakery, two cafés, a deli, a butcher, a post office, and tourist information, is also reachable within a short drive. If you want to partake in some Lakeland activities, Coniston is a shortdrive away and Windermere isalso easily accessible by car. Grizebeck is in a prime location for exploring a number of Lake District sites, such as the Ravenglass Railway, the South Lakes Animal Park close to Dalton, and Dalton Castle, Muncaster Castle, and the South Lakes Animal Park.
